Scammers trying to collect information to take money

scamPhoto Provided

Don't fall victim to phishing scams. There has been an increase of concerned citizens that have received this text messages. Some worry that their identities will be stolen as they have not filed for unemployment. If you receive this text message dont do anything with just delete it or contact local law enforcement.
